[Management of vertigo and dizziness]
D Bouccara1, F Rubin2, P Bonfils2
1Service d'ORL et de chirurgie cervico-faciale, hôpital européen Georges-Pompidou, hôpitaux universitaires Paris-Ouest, Assistance-publique-Hôpitaux de Paris, 20, rue Leblanc, 75015 Paris, France.
Abstract:
Balance disorders presenting with symptoms of dizziness and vertigo are due to various diseases. Clinical approach gives the opportunity to identify emergency situations and most common causes, among them the first one being the benign paroxysmal positional vertigo. Oculomotor assessment is pertinent as major clinical orientation, particularly between peripheral and central diseases. These clinical findings support the respective indication of modern imaging and/or vestibular tests, focused on the direction of presupposed diagnosis. On elderly the risk of falls and their complications needs a specific evaluation.
